#cf06f9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cf06f9 is composed of 81.2% red, 2.4%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.9% cyan, 97.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 289.6 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 50%. #cf06f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0cff with #9f00f3. Closest websafe color is: #cc00ff.

Shades and Tints of #cf06f9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100013 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#cf06f9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#827c83 is the less saturated color, while #cf06f9 is the most saturated one.
